## โš™๏ธ Configuration

You can configure the agent to use either OpenAI (default) or a local Ollama instance.

### Option 1: OpenAI (Default)
Powerful, zero-setup (requires API Key).

```bash
export OPENAI_API_KEY=sk-...
export RESEARCH_DB_PATH=~/research_db
export LLM_PROVIDER=openai
```

### Option 2: Ollama (Local & Private)
Run entirely on your machine. No API keys required.

1. **Pull Models**:
   ```bash
   ollama pull llama3.2
   ollama pull nomic-embed-text
   ```

2. **Configure Environment**:
   ```bash
   export RESEARCH_DB_PATH=~/research_db
   export LLM_PROVIDER=ollama
   # Optional overrides
   # export OLLAMA_BASE_URL=http://localhost:11434
   ```

### Claude Desktop Setup
Add this to your `claude_desktop_config.json`:

```json
{
  "mcpServers": {
    "kavi-research": {
      "command": "uvx",
      "args": ["kavi-research-assistant-mcp"],
      "env": {
        "RESEARCH_DB_PATH": "/Users/username/research_db",
        "OPENAI_API_KEY": "sk-..." 
      }
    }
  }
}
```

## ๐Ÿ› ๏ธ MCP Tool Reference

Model Context Protocol (MCP) allows Kavi to act as a bridge between your AI and a private knowledge base. Below are the tools provided:

### 1. ๐Ÿ“ฅ Data Ingestion
*   **`save_research_data(content: List[str], topic: str)`**: Saves raw text or snippets. 
    *   *Usecase*: Saving paper abstracts or news headlines.
*   **`save_research_files(file_paths: List[str], topic: str)`**: Parses and vectorizes documents.
    *   *Supported Formats*: `.pdf`, `.txt`, `.docx`.
    *   *Usecase*: Ingesting a folder of research PDF papers.

### 2. ๐Ÿ” Knowledge Retrieval & RAG
*   **`ask_research_topic(query: str, topic: str)`**: Answers questions using **Retrieval Augmented Generation**.
    *   *Usecase*: "What does my research say about Agentic Workflows?"
*   **`summarize_topic(topic: str)`**: Generates a high-level executive summary of an entire library.
    *   *Usecase*: Periodic review of a project topic.

### 3. ๐Ÿ“‹ Management
*   **`list_research_topics()`**: Returns a list of all libraries and their document counts.
*   **`search_research_data(query: str, topic: str)`**: Performs raw semantic similarity search for specific chunks.

## ๐Ÿงช Testing & Usage Steps

### Step 1: Initialize the Environment
Ensure your preferred LLM backend is running. For Ollama:
```bash
ollama serve
ollama pull llama3.2
ollama pull nomic-embed-text
```

### Step 2: Launch the Assistant
You can interact via the **MCP Inspector** (Command Line) or the **Web UI**.

**To test via MCP Inspector:**
```bash
npx @modelcontextprotocol/inspector uv run kavi-research-assistant-mcp
```
Once the inspector opens in your browser, you can manually trigger tools like `list_research_topics`.

### Step 3: Populate with Knowledge
Ask your AI (via Claude Desktop or the UI) to save information:
> *"Save the following text to my 'ai-market' topic: [Your Text Here]"*

### Step 4: Validate RAG (The "Proof of Work")
Ask a question that **only** your saved data could answer:
> *"Based on my 'ai-market' data, what was the projected growth for 2026?"*

### Step 5: Dashboard Review
Open the UI to see your topic cards visualized gracefully.
```bash
uv run kavi-research-ui
```

## ๐Ÿ’ก Typical Usecase Scenarios

1.  **Academic Research**: Upload 50 PDF papers into a topic called `thesis`. Use `ask_research_topic` to find contradictions or common methodologies across all papers.
2.  **Market Intelligence**: Save daily news snippets about competitors into `competitor-intel`. Every Friday, run `summarize_topic` to get a weekly briefing.
3.  **Code Library**: Save documentation for obscure libraries into `dev-docs`. Use Kavi to answer "How do I implement X using Y?" without the LLM hallucinating.
